ABOUT US

Progressive Media Investments is a modern media company behind some of the UK’s most influential brands. From New Statesman and Press Gazette to Elite Traveler, Spear’s and The World of Fine Wine, our portfolio spans politics, business, luxury and lifestyle. We combine trusted journalism with data and events to deliver insight, analysis and experiences that engage audiences and shape conversations. With a focus on digital transformation and growth, we are a fast-moving, ambitious organisation with a collaborative culture.
In addition to supporting Progressive Media Investments, this role will also cover payroll operations for several privately owned businesses within the Danson family portfolio, including The Samling Hotel, Estel, and Accelerate Ventures. This offers a unique opportunity to work across a diverse set of industries - from media and investment to luxury hospitality - delivering accurate, end-to-end payroll support in a fast-paced and high-trust environment.

S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E

  • CIPP qualification, and/or equivalent relevant experience running end-to-end payroll in a multi-entity environment.
  • Up-to-date knowledge of UK payroll legislation, pension compliance, and auto-enrolment.
  • Experience working with outsourced payroll providers (preferably US and international exposure).
  • Experience managing relationships with benefits brokers or benefits providers.
  • HR administration experience, ideally within recruitment, contracts, and benefits.
  • Proficiency in HRIS or payroll systems (experience with Rippling desirable but not essential).
  • High attention to detail, accuracy, and ability to meet deadlines.
  • Strong communication skills and ability to work effectively with employees at all levels.
  • Proactive, organised, and able to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.

ROLE OVERVIEW

We are seeking an experienced Senior Payroll and HR Adviser to take ownership of our end-to-end payroll operations and provide high-quality HR support. Reporting to the Head of HR, this is a hands-on role requiring excellent attention to detail, strong organisational skills, and the ability to manage multiple payrolls across different entities. The role also includes line management of a part-time Payroll Administrator and broader HR responsibilities including recruitment administration, contract and benefit coordination, HRIS management, and benefits administration.
The role will be based in our Hull office, and may require occasional travel to our head office in London.
